Description
Camp Sunshine at Sebago Lake offers retreats that combine respite, recreation and support for children with life-threatening illnesses and their families. Founded in 1984, the camp's mission is to enable hope and promote joy throughout the various stages of a child's illness. Their programs include a camp experience specifically designed for these families. The camp is located in Casco, ME.
